I've had both Dish and DirecTV and I ultimately prefer DirecTV. I had quite a few technical issues in my home with Dish that they could not resolve, that and the Tribune Broadcast dispute is why I switched back. I have a 55'' 4KTV in my basement, when I had the hopper 3 the PQ was nowhere as good as the quality I got with the C61K from DTV. I might pay a bit more with DirecTV but I feel like it's more of a premium service than Dish and worth the extra money. DTV has more channels in HD than Dish (in particular Disney XD for Star Wars Rebels).
